Dehalogenative Cross-Coupling of gem-Difluoroalkenes with Alkyl Halides via a Silyl Radical-Mediated Process.

Herein, we describe a convenient general protocol for monofluoroalkenylation reactions of alkyl bromides involving cooperative visible-light photoredox catalysis and halogen abstraction. Mechanistic experiments showed that the products were generated by selective cross-coupling of aliphatic radicals with fluoroalkenyl radicals. Silyl radical-mediated halogen abstraction enabled the protocol to be used for the monofluoroalkenylation of a broad range of alkyl and heteroaryl halides. The protocol could be carried out on a gram scale and was applied to cholesterol, indicating its utility for late-stage monofluoroalkenylation reactions.
